Abstract:

This book explores the interfaces of English as a Lingua Franca (ELF) and
English as a Foreign Language (EFL) pedagogy. It presents the theoretical
aspects of ELF, discusses issues and challenges that ELF raises for the EFL
classroom, and demonstrates how EFL practitioners can make use of ELF
theorizing for classroom instruction, teacher education, developing language
learning materials, policymaking and testing and assessment. Accounts of
innovative and practical pedagogical practices and researchers’ insights from
diverse geographical, cultural and institutional contexts will inform and
inspire EFL practitioners to reconsider their practices and adopt new
techniques in order to meet their learners’ diverse communicative needs in
international contexts.
